Geological formations and unique features of Madagascar’s caves

Madagascar’s caves feature geological characteristics that set them apart from typical underground sites. Limestone dominates the landscape, allowing the development of deep and complex cavities. Some caves, like those in Tsingy de Bemaraha, present highly pronounced *karst* formations, creating narrow passages and impressive chambers. Water erosion has sculpted remarkable and sometimes unstable structures, making each visit distinctive and requiring careful preparation.

Stalactites and stalagmites: mineral formation and age

Stalactites and stalagmites form from the gradual deposition of minerals dissolved in water. Observing these formations provides insight into the caves’ age: some stalactites measure several meters and took thousands of years to develop. Calcium, calcium carbonate, and traces of iron or manganese give varied colours, from bright white to orange shades. Each stalactite serves as a natural archive, documenting historical climatic conditions with remarkable precision.

Underground rivers and their ecological impact

Madagascar’s underground rivers are more than hidden waterways: they play a crucial role in maintaining ecological balance. These hydrological networks feed aquifers and maintain cave humidity, creating microhabitats for endemic species. Troglobitic fish and certain crustaceans adapted to total darkness illustrate the specific evolution of these ecosystems. Understanding river flow and chemical composition allows better protection of these fragile environments.

  • Underground rivers regulate freshwater distribution to surrounding areas.
  • Seasonal variations can cause temporary flooding, reshaping cave topography.
  • Mineral deposits create unique formations and support cave biodiversity.
  • Microclimates inside caves sustain rare endemic species.

Visiting techniques and protecting Madagascar’s subterranean sites

Accessing these hidden caves and rivers requires organization and knowledge of preservation practices. Some cavities are fragile and sensitive to human activity. Staying on marked paths, limiting strong lights, and avoiding contact with formations help minimize impact. Equipment should include non-slip shoes and clothing suitable for humid conditions, with safety as a top priority, especially in areas with unstable rock.

Preserving cave and river integrity

Protecting these environments requires certain rules: limiting simultaneous visitors, avoiding waste, and monitoring cave humidity and temperature. Local and scientific initiatives track human impact and adjust routes as needed. Some fish and crustacean species may disappear if ecological balance is disturbed. Being aware of these constraints allows you to enjoy the caves’ beauty while contributing to their protection.

  • Respect restricted zones to protect geological formations.
  • Use soft light sources to avoid disturbing sensitive species.
  • Participate in supervised monitoring or cleanup programs.
  • Avoid touching mineral deposits to prevent altering natural development.
